WORK RIGHTS
Students receive permission to work with their visa grant. They are not permitted to work until they have started their course. Students can work up to 20 hours a week while their course is in session (excluding any work undertaken as a registered component of study or training) and they can work unlimited hours during scheduled course breaks. Family members of students are not allowed to work until the student begins the course. They are allowed to work up to 20 hours per week at all times.
Family members of students who have started a masters or doctorate course may work unlimited hours. See: http://www.immi.gov.au/students/student-information.htm for more details. Students should contact the Department if Immigration and Citizenship (DIAC) in Australia for the latest requirements as these requirements vary.
